organoleptics :
|
| odor type : | citrus |
| odor strength : | high , recommend smelling in a 1.00 % solution or less |
odor description :¹ at 1.00 % in dipropylene glycol. | citrus metallic mandarin orange waxy aldehydic |
| odor sample from : | Firmenich & Company Inc. |
| substantivity : | 72 hour(s) at 10.00 % in dipropylene glycol |
properties :
|
| appearence : | colorless clear oily liquid |
| assay : | 96.00 to 100.00 % sum of isomers
|
| Food Chemicals Codex Listed : | Yes |
| specific gravity : | 0.83900 to 0.84900 @ 25.00 °C.
|
| pounds per gallon - calc. : | 6.981 to 7.065
|
| refractive index : | 1.46200 to 1.46400 @ 20.00 °C.
|
| boiling point : | 73.00 to 74.00 °C. @ 0.50 mm Hg
|
| boiling point : | 125.00 to 128.00 °C. @ 760.00 mm Hg
|
| vapor pressure : | 0.01000 mm/Hg @ 20.00 °C. |
| flash point : | > 212.00 °F. TCC ( > 100.00 °C. )
|
| logP (o/w) : | 4.76 |
